The Kanata Blazers & The Alberton PEE Wees

Kids can change the world! Two amazing hockey teams – The Kanata Blazers from Ottawa and The Alberton Pee Wees from P.E.I. were both nominated for the Chevrolet Good Deeds Cup. The Kanata Blazers decided to help Jonathan Pitre who is affected by Epidermolysis Bullosa and his charity DEBRA Canada.

When the Alberton team heard about Patient Ambassador Jonathan Pitre thru the Blazers, they decided they wanted to help too. Both teams raised a large amount of money for our charity through their fundraising efforts and helped raise EB Awareness across the country. PCL Constructors Canada Inc. - Toronto District Building Community Program

A BIG thank you to PCL Constructors Canada Inc., (as part of PCL Constructors Canada Inc. Toronto District – Building Community program) who hosted the first annual EB Awareness Obstacle Course Event at Players Paradise in Stoney Creek, ON just past Monday October 19, 2015. 50+ attendees participated and simulated everyday tasks that could cause significant trauma to those affected by EB.
